Path: utzoo!utgpu!news-server.csri.toronto.edu!cs.utexas.edu!sun-barr!lll-winken!elroy.jpl.nasa.gov!sdd.hp.com!zaphod.mps.ohio-state.edu!think.com!linus!linus!thelonius!john From: john@thelonius.mitre.org (John D. Burger) Newsgroups: comp.lang.lisp Subject: Re: SETF of LET Summary: Oops Message-ID: <1991May23.182123.23544@linus.mitre.org> Date: 23 May 91 18:21:23 GMT Sender: news@linus.mitre.org (News Service) Organization: The MITRE Corporation, Bedford, MA 01730 Lines: 12 Nntp-Posting-Host: thelonius.mitre.org Concerning the implementation I posted, I just realized that it doesn't do the right thing with respect to declarations in the body of the LET. Those need to be parsed out of the body, and then the internal WRAP-IT function needs to include them. The code also ought to check for IGNOREs in these declarations, just in case some idiot binds a variable and then immediately ignores it. All of this results in an even more odious piece of code than already exists. -- John Burger john@mitre.org "You ever think about .signature files? I mean, do we really need them?" - alt.andy.rooney